动手写一个简单的浏览器扩展插件 - markdown文件本地预览

平时写文档的时候,一些简单的文档都用 markdown来写,编辑工具自然是随便用的,记事本、vs code或者专门的 md编辑器都可以,但是想要预览的时候,却有一定的限制,例如我想用 vs code预览 md文件,就必须装一个专门的插件,或者干脆就要开启一个 md编辑器才行,而我的本意其实仅仅是想预览一个写好的 md文档,不会做任何的改动,上面几种做法也不费什么事,但未免有些多余,毕竟,代码编辑器是用来写代码的,而且是本就已经开了很多个窗口了,不想再开一个了,至于专门的 md编辑器更是要开启一个编辑器,更麻烦。
而浏览器几乎是时时刻刻开着的,并且在浏览器上预览更敞亮,于是想着能不能找一个浏览器的md预览插件,结果找了半天没找到(可能是我找的方法有问题),于是还是决定自己写一个吧。


参考文档:

Chrome扩展程序的相关资料:
- Chrome扩展及应用开发(首发版)
- 360极速浏览器应用开发平台


manifest.json 配置文件

首先,一个 Chrome插件,肯定要有 manifest.json这个文件,此文件可以看做是插件的配置文件,插件所需加载的脚本文件、样式文件、图标、启动时刻、版本号等都在此文件中定义,一个最简单的 Chrome插件,只需要一个 manifest.json就足够了。

所以,在项目根目录新建 manifest.json,写入以下基本配置:

{
  "manifest_version": 2,
  "name": "MdPriview",
  "version": "1.0",
  "description": "预览本地 markdown文件",
  "content_scripts": [
    {
      "matches": ["file:///*.md"],
      "js": ["js/index.js"],
      "run_at": "document_end",
    }
  ],
  "icons": {
    "16": "img/16.png",
    "48": "img/48.png",
    "128"
  • 3
    点赞
  • 15
    收藏
    觉得还不错? 一键收藏
  • 3
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值